Abrupt Images
Photo by JJ Shev on Unsplash

In the puddle,

After the rain stops,

My reflection in the crystal water,

Dark, dull, gray.

Stares back from the underground,

As I stare at my reflection in the puddle,

I sit down with my still open umbrella,

Making it darker to see.

And the clouds rumbling,

Giving a warning to pour down again,

I touch one finger and see the image waver,

Just as my mind when I see him.

I rose back abruptly,

Regretting my minds decision to show me images, that I abandoned,

I splashed into the puddle disrupting,

The images and the world within.
